Lindsay F.

Dr. Bui and Dr. Mitri filled in for our regular OBGYN from FOWH when she was out on vacay. They got us through a 50-hour failed induction turned c-section and delivered our son on 7/8! They did the c-section together, but Dr. Bui was the one we saw the most in the hospital. Dr. Mitri came to check on us during the induction process and he officially checked us out of the hospital, too. He was super nice and informative and made sure we had all of our concerns addressed. He made a very stressful and scary situation feel less dramatic, which was much appreciated by us - two first time parents! Thank you for getting our son here safe and sound!
